Title:
  [Network Printing] Low On Toner Forces username/password
  Authentication

Status in cups package in Ubuntu:
  Incomplete

Bug description:
  Under cups/core-drivers/1.7.2-0ubuntu1.7, printing over the network to
  a Lexmark cx310dn.

  AuthInfoRequired username,password

  keeps resurfacing in /etc/cups/printers.conf (even after removing 
/etc/cups/printers.conf.O when cupsd is stopped and forcing "AuthInfoRequired 
None") when the target printer is low on toner.
  However, the web GUI provides no way of authenticating the job and to 
override the warning.

  Embarrassing--not to mention time consuming when you're trying to
  debug the beast.
